1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What was the Bataan Death March?
Back
A forced march of American and Filipino prisoners by Japanese forces.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What was the primary objective of the D-Day invasion of Normandy?
Back
To establish a Western front against Germany

4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which battle is considered the turning point in the Pacific Theater during World War II?
Back
Battle of Midway
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What was the outcome of the Battle of Midway?
Back
A significant victory for the U.S. Navy, crippling the Japanese fleet.

7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What role did General Dwight D. Eisenhower play in World War II?
Back
He was the Commander of the Allied Expeditionary Force in Europe for the D-Day invasion.
